CVE-2014-0189 is a credential exposure issue in virt-who. The configuration file /etc/sysconfig/virt-who was world-readable and could contain unencrypted hypervisor passwords, allowing local users on the host to read sensitive virtualization credentials. Exposure is most likely on systems running virt-who where /etc/sysconfig/virt-who exists, is readable by non-privileged local users, and contains hypervisor credentials. The bundle does not identify precise affected versions. Treat this as a targeted remediation item for virtualization management hosts. It is not evidenced as internet-exploited, but exposed hypervisor credentials can create serious downstream risk if local users or compromised accounts can read them. Mitigation focus: Review RHSA-2015:0430 and apply vendor fixes where applicable.; Restrict /etc/sysconfig/virt-who permissions to authorized administrators only.; Rotate any hypervisor passwords stored in the exposed file..
